In 2007 CoisCéim BROADREACH was again approached by CIE to lead the dance element of GUTBUSTERS! a health promotion programme designed to enable Dublin Bus employees from 8 depots in Dublin to improve their general health and increase their level of fitness. 

Using the same structural model as in 2006, employees were encouraged to sign up to a two month programme of health activities that included a variety of health seminars, dietary advice, and a competitive weight loss league with walking, gym – and dance challenges.

GUTBUSTERS! and CoisCéim BROADREACH

Similarly to 2006, Dublin bus drivers and staff self-selected to take part in weekly dance classes and to participate in a final celebratory performance. Focussing on building general fitness and greater body-awareness through participation in fun dance exercise, the participants worked once again with the two lead dance artists to create choreography – this time a western inspired dance piece entitled LIBERTY WEST. 

Working closely throughout the project with lead GUTBUSTERS! Organiser, Health Promotion Officer Anne Farrell, much attention was given to promoting the core values of the project – to encourage people to exercise, to adopt an active life-style, and to build personal motivation and self-confidence.

The health programme GUTBUSTERS! culminated in a celebratory end event at the Tivoli Theatre In November 2007. This included a wildly entertaining performance of LIBERTY WEST by a cast of 35 gutsy bus drivers and administrative staff. Once again, it was received with great enthusiasm by a supportive audience, to much applause, laughter and congratulations.
